The expression ( 15)^4, or 15 to the fourth power, can be written as the product of four 15 terms. Knowing this, we can complete the first three boxes. (1/5)^4 &= 1/5 * 1/5 * 1/5 * 1/5 &=Now, to fill the last box, we will multiply 15 four times.
(1/5)^4
1/5 * 1/5 * 1/5 * 1/5
1 * 1 * 1 * 1 * 1/5 * 5 * 5 * 5 * 5
1/5 * 5 * 5 * 5 * 5
1/3125
Let's fully complete the boxes! (1/5)^4 &= 1/5 * 1/5 * 1/5 * 1/5 &=1/3125
